1. Understanding the Sales Booking Process and Its Impact on Revenue

Bookings are the lifeblood of businesses dependent on sales-driven revenue. This process encompasses the recording of a sale or commitment from a customer which, while not yet billed or fulfilled, is a solid indicator of future earnings. A clear comprehension of how bookings work and their timelines is fundamental to forecasting revenue and managing company resources efficiently.

When bookings are adeptly managed, they enable a predictable and regular inflow of cash, essential for maintaining and growing business operations. An effective booking process avoids overpromise and under-delivery, balancing anticipation with realistic projections. In essence, it serves as a roadmap for your business’s financial journey, highlighting pathways to success and illuminating potential hazards.

A detailed understanding of bookings involves recognizing how they are categorized, what signifies a completed booking, and the legal implications that accompany these business agreements. The intricacies of this aspect, such as comprehending sales bookings, can affect procurement, inventory management, and even customer success strategies. Inaccuracies or inefficiencies within this process can lead to cash flow problems and loss of customer trust.

3. Leveraging Analytics to Refine Your Booking Funnel

Data analysis is the compass that guides a ship through the tumultuous seas of the sales industry. Leveraging analytics is pivotal in understanding customer behaviors and refining your sales booking funnel accordingly. By tracking user interactions and pinpointing where potential clients drop off or convert, you gain valuable insights into optimizing the sales journey.

A closer look at metrics such as conversion rates, time spent on page, and click-through rates can reveal much about the effectiveness of your sales funnel. Sophisticated analytics tools can also help segment your audience, providing a granular view of how different customer profiles interact with your platform. Personalizing the sales approach based on these insights can result in warmer leads and higher conversion rates.

4. Implementing Effective Call-to-Action to Boost Bookings

A call-to-action (CTA) is the linchpin in translating interest into action. A strong, well-placed CTA guides customers through the buying process, reducing friction and inviting immediate response. Whether it’s to schedule a demo, sign up for a trial, or proceed to payment, the right CTA can increase the velocity of your sales funnel.

CTAs must be visually distinct and content-specific to be effective. Simplistic as it may sound, the color, size, and placement of a CTA button can materially affect its performance. Equally important is the language used; it should be actionable, value-oriented, and instill a sense of urgency or exclusivity to incentivize immediate engagement.
